Back to search


Published in ESG

OWL Analytics & Investment Research is a data and indexing company that offers detailed data and metrics on the environmental, social, and governance (ESG) characteristics of global equities.

  • BIG DATA APPROACH – employs a big data approach to generating ESG scores, peer ranks, and peer percentiles, based on the largest foundation of data for every company covered.
  • CONSENSUS BASED – leverages the collective intelligence of hundreds of sources of ESG data and research to generate consensus metrics for every company on various common ESG themes.
  • COMPREHENSIVE COVERAGE – offers comprehensive coverage of 25,000+ global equities.
  • MONTHLY FREQUENCY – publishes ESG metrics monthly rather than yearly.

OWL monitors various types of ESG information sources — including but not limited to corporate filings, CSR reports, news sources, and NGO research — to track companies on over 180 environmental, social, governance, controversial revenue, and UN Global Impact data points. OWL ESG covers over 95% of the weight of most major indices and offers coverage of smallcap, emerging market, and frontier market companies. OWL ESG scores and rankings are updated monthly rather than yearly.

Key Features and Coverage on RIMES

For this data source, RIMES hosts data for approximately 34845 companies.

  • Company items include: Company Name, ISIN, FIGI share class, Region, Global Sector Count, Global Sub-Sector Count, Global Industry Count, Region Sector Count, Region Sub-Sector Count, Region Industry Count, etc.
  • Key Performance Indicators include: Pollution Prevention, Environmental Transparency, Resource Efficiency, Compensation & Satisfaction, Diversity & Rights, Education & Work Conditions, Community & Charity, Sustainability Integration, Board Effectiveness, Management Ethics, Disclosure & Accountability, and more.
  • Regional identifier items include: Sector Rank, Sub-Sector Rank, Industry Rank, Sector Percentile, Sub-Sector Percentile, Industry Percentile, and more.
  • Score-based items include: ESG Positive Correlation and ESG Total Correlation


Explore more from : ESG

Our Managed Data Services

  • Working with 650+ partners and 1600 data sets
  • Superior data quality and accuracy
  • 75,000 index, price & reference data feeds delivered daily
  • Fully managed, validated and system-ready feeds
  • Data delivered via API or file format for operational or analytical users
  • Increase business agility and scalability
  • Faster time to quality & market
  • Global expert 24/7 support

Looking for specific data?

Get in touch. We can source specific data, just for you.